#86831b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#86831b is composed of 52.5% red, 51.4%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.2% magenta, 79.9%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 58.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 31.6%. #86831b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ff36 with #0d0700.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#86831b color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
#86831b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#86831b has RGB values of R:134, G:131,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.8,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8815387.

Shades and Tints of #86831b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#86831b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#54544d is the less saturated color, while #9f9a02 is the most saturated one.
